FileDocCategorySizeDatePackage
RepIdDelegator_1_3.javaAPI DocJava SE 5 API4576Fri Aug 26 14:54:28 BST 2005com.sun.corba.se.impl.orbutil

RepIdDelegator_1_3

public final class RepIdDelegator_1_3 extends Object implements RepositoryIdUtility, RepositoryIdInterface, RepositoryIdStrings
Delegates to the RepositoryId_1_3 implementation in com.sun.corba.se.impl.orbutil. This is necessary to overcome the fact that many of RepositoryId's methods are static.

Fields Summary
private RepositoryId_1_3
delegate
Constructors Summary
public RepIdDelegator_1_3()

private RepIdDelegator_1_3(RepositoryId_1_3 _delegate)

        this.delegate = _delegate;
    
Methods Summary
public java.lang.StringcreateForAnyType(java.lang.Class type)

        return RepositoryId_1_3.createForAnyType(type);
    
public java.lang.StringcreateForJavaType(java.io.Serializable ser)

        return RepositoryId_1_3.createForJavaType(ser);
    
public java.lang.StringcreateForJavaType(java.lang.Class clz)

        return RepositoryId_1_3.createForJavaType(clz);
    
public java.lang.StringcreateSequenceRepID(java.lang.Object ser)

        return RepositoryId_1_3.createSequenceRepID(ser);
    
public java.lang.StringcreateSequenceRepID(java.lang.Class clazz)

        return RepositoryId_1_3.createSequenceRepID(clazz);
    
public booleanequals(java.lang.Object obj)

        if (delegate != null)
            return delegate.equals(obj);
        else
            return super.equals(obj);
    
public java.lang.StringgetClassDescValueRepId()

        return RepositoryId_1_3.kClassDescValueRepID;
    
public java.lang.ClassgetClassFromType()

        return delegate.getClassFromType();
    
public java.lang.ClassgetClassFromType(java.lang.String codebaseURL)

        return delegate.getClassFromType(codebaseURL);
    
public java.lang.ClassgetClassFromType(java.lang.Class expectedType, java.lang.String codebaseURL)

        return delegate.getClassFromType(expectedType, codebaseURL);
    
public java.lang.StringgetClassName()

        return delegate.getClassName();
    
public intgetCodeBaseRMIChunkedId()

        return RepositoryId.kPreComputed_CodeBaseRMIChunked;
    
public intgetCodeBaseRMIChunkedNoRepStrId()

        return RepositoryId.kPreComputed_CodeBaseRMIChunked_NoRep;
    
public intgetCodeBaseRMIUnchunkedId()

        return RepositoryId.kPreComputed_CodeBaseRMIUnchunked;
    
public intgetCodeBaseRMIUnchunkedNoRepStrId()

        return RepositoryId.kPreComputed_CodeBaseRMIUnchunked_NoRep;
    
public RepositoryIdInterfacegetFromString(java.lang.String repIdString)

        return new RepIdDelegator_1_3(RepositoryId_1_3.cache.getId(repIdString));
    
public intgetStandardRMIChunkedId()

        return RepositoryId.kPreComputed_StandardRMIChunked;
    
public intgetStandardRMIChunkedNoRepStrId()

        return RepositoryId.kPreComputed_StandardRMIChunked_NoRep;
    
public intgetStandardRMIUnchunkedId()

        return RepositoryId.kPreComputed_StandardRMIUnchunked;
    
public intgetStandardRMIUnchunkedNoRepStrId()

	return RepositoryId.kPreComputed_StandardRMIUnchunked_NoRep;
    
public intgetTypeInfo(int valueTag)

        return RepositoryId.getTypeInfo(valueTag);
    
public java.lang.StringgetWStringValueRepId()

        return RepositoryId_1_3.kWStringValueRepID;
    
public booleanisChunkedEncoding(int valueTag)

        return RepositoryId.isChunkedEncoding(valueTag);
    
public booleanisCodeBasePresent(int valueTag)

        return RepositoryId.isCodeBasePresent(valueTag);
    
public java.lang.StringtoString()


       
        if (delegate != null)
            return delegate.toString();
        else
            return this.getClass().getName();